William Blake was born on November 28 1757 in the Soho district in London.
-
-
William Blake went to school only long enough to learn how to read and write.
-
William Blake became an aprenticed engraver to James Basire. William was into the arts at a very early age because of his father who encouraged him.
-
Blake became a student at The Royal Academy. He went there for six years and did not have to pay but had to provide his own supplies.
